BmileCast #12 for November 28, 2011
Our inaugural BmileCast podcast for the 2011-12 school year begins with a book report from Rachel and Grace on Roald Dahl's novel entitled "Danny, Champion of the World." We then get a sports update from Connor and Spencer, followed by some excellent narrative writing pieces from Natalie, Parker, Avery, and Griffin. Next up, we hear from Joleigh, with a very informative report on four Native American Indian tribes we studied earlier this fall. We then close out our podcast with additional narrative pieces from Rachel, Nate, and Ana. We hope you enjoy our show!

BmileCast #11 for January 27, 2011
Our first BmileCast of 2011 will include a number of special treats from our fifth graders in Room 6. First, Zack will bring us an eyewitness report of the recent BCS College Football Championship game between the University of Oregon Ducks and the Auburn Tigers. After that, Kamala and Sam share some unique memories from their holidays this past year and other related family traditions. Griffin and Brian present some challenging math story problems, and Samantha and Olivia finish our podcast off with a dramatic rendition of Henry Wadsworth Longfellow's poem from 1860, "Paul Revere's Ride." So fasten your stirrups onto your boots and saddle up; I think you'll really enjoy our premier BmileCast for the 2010-11 school year!

BmileCast #10 for June 6, 2010
BmileCast hits the road as we go on our Willamette Jetboat field trip. Mr. Black interviews a few students on the bus ride to and from the dock near OMSI. Even though it was an overcast and cool day in Portland, we all had a great time! Next, Peyton reads President Lincoln's famous Gettysburg Address, Belle and Zach interview Ms. Ghattas (our principal at Bridlemile), and we hear a composition from Chloe, who has been recovering from surgery since December 2009 to remove a tumor from her brainstem. Brianna and Zoie read Chloe's composition on her behalf.

BmileCast #8 for February 16, 2009
Zoe serves as our charming host this time, with Elizabeth starting things off with a review of the Presidential Inauguration of Barack Obama on January 20th, 2009. Zach then provides us with an exciting summary of Super Bowl XLIII. Mr. Black interviews Richard, one of our classmates with a Russian background in his family, then Zanna reviews one of her favorite online game sites: Miniclip.com. Emma concludes our show by breaking down the historical origin of Valentine's Day for us, and Spencer and Julia read two color poems ("Red" and "Pink") from Mary O'Neill's "Hailstones and Halibut Bones."

BmileCast #7 for November 11, 2008
Mr. Black serves as host this week as we are introduced to constellation myths inspired by Ursa Major. Isaac, Max, Claire, Perry, and Mason share their creative talents with their "spacey" compositions. Jackson then provides us with an update on the "wide world of sports." Following that, Noah, Taylor, and Chris read autumn-inspired color poems from the classic book of poetry by Mary O'Neill, "Hailstones and Halibut Bones." Finally, Evin continues her journey through our solar system with a pit stop at the "third rock from the Sun" and our good old lunar friend, the Moon.
